This is also part of the Renewal series, it is the first part with the person trapped in all their negativty before the water cleanses them. / This series was inspired by the song “New Soul” by Yael Naim. These pictures were quite a challenge as the model struggled to move and stay afloat with all the heavy material wrapped around her yet at the same time would float to the top with the air in her lungs.
